Neoen Hosts Open House for Jumbo Solar Project near Fort Macleod

Neoen, the developer behind the Jumbo Solar with Storage Project, is inviting residents and stakeholders to a community open house scheduled for February 20, 2024, at the REO Hall in Fort MacLeod. The event will run from 5:00 pm to 8:00 pm and will provide an informal platform for engagement and dialogue regarding the proposed solar initiative.

The Jumbo Solar with Storage Project, spearheaded by Neoen Renewables Canada Inc., commenced development in 2022. The proposed project spans approximately 1,500 acres of land approximately 1.6 km southwest of Fort Macleod within the Municipal District of Willow Creek No. 26.  

Neoen emphasizes that the open house will feature subject matter experts available to address stakeholder inquiries and concerns. Acknowledging the unique nature of stakeholder interests, the event seeks to foster meaningful discussions tailored to individual needs. However, for those unable to attend or prefer a more personalized consultation, arrangements for private meetings can be made by contacting Neoen directly.
